TSA Workforce Rights: Enhanced Job Security and Benefits
This act aims to improve working conditions and job stability for Transportation Security Administration (TSA) employees by granting them the same rights and benefits as other civil service employees. This means TSA workers will receive greater protection regarding pay, leave, and health insurance, as well as access to mental health support programs.
Key points
TSA employees will receive the same rights and benefits as other federal employees, including pay and benefits protection.
Safeguards against reductions in pay and benefits, and preservation of accrued leave, will be implemented.
Mental health programs will be established for Federal Air Marshal Service employees.
The act prioritizes the hiring of veterans and preference eligibles for TSA positions.
TSA employees will be provided with guidance and resources for illness prevention, including coronavirus.
